Unlike the Midwest or Northeast regions of the country, Charlotte is not really considered “basement” territory. Part of the reason is all that wonderful red clay that is so much a part of our state’s heritage. That same clay is extremely dense and retains water like a sponge. Those are two conditions which don’t make for decent basement building. A lot of new homes will have what they call a “walk out” basement which are often built on plots of land that have a slope to them and can support this kind of construction. In older homes, you’ll find more cellars than basements. Even though both of these spaces are under the house, a cellar is used more for storage than as a family room. Recycling News in Charlotte

For this year’s Earth Day celebrations the University of North Carolina at Charlotte has reason to be very proud of themselves. Last year the campus broke their own record by recycling over 2,000,000 pounds of garbage. If you know a college aged student then you can appreciate how much garbage they can generate! UNC also was able to divert 39% of the campus trash away from landfills. This year the UNC Charlotte’s Office of Waste Reduction and Recycling Projects say that they are on target to break their own record once again and plan to hold a huge party on Earth Day.

At this year’s Earth Day celebration many campus organizations will be involved in the festivities. Among them will be the work of UNC Charlotte’s Sustainability Office, Charlotte Green Initiative, Venture, Earth Club, Geography Club and Recreational Services. The engineering students are also getting into the spirit of recycling with their unveiling of two original interactive recycling bins. One of the bins which is meant for indoor use will start a football themed game whenever someone drops a can into the bin. The second been is powered by a small solar panel and launches a game inspired by the Price is Right. Both of these bins will be up and active starting this summer.

As if these accomplishments weren’t enough the Carolina Recycling Association also named UNC Charlotte’s recycling department as “the best among many colleges and universities in the Carolinas.”

There is a unique program coming to Charlotte as part of Holocaust Remembrance gatherings. There are 18 violins that had been repaired by a special shop in Tel Aviv. These violins are no ordinary musical instruments but instead were once owned by Jewish musicians who played them in the death camps and ghettos of World War II. For the last several years Amnon Weinstein has been on a quest to find these special instruments and has scoured the attics and basements around the world. Now these fully restored violins will be part of a musical celebration honoring their previous owners. The wacky weather that has hit the country this year has brought spring into the Charlotte area a lot sooner than anyone anticipated. The result is that pollen is everywhere. It’s covering Lake Norman, dusting cars and the ground. By some estimates this is the worst season for pollen in over ten years.

All of this can be traced back to the warm weather that has swept through the Charlotte area. On the average it has been five degrees higher than normal. This has tricked plants and trees into blooming earlier and in a short amount of time. Normally, this blooming is spread out over a couple of weeks which allows the pollen to spread out a bit more. Now it has exploded in two days which has left many residents heading indoors. What are the numbers? Last year the oak pollen count was just 1,200 grams per cubic meter. This year the count was as high as 8,829 grams per cubic meter. That’s a lot of pollen.

The slogan of these eco-friendly programs is “recycle, repurpose and reuse.” The recycling part comes down to a matter of separating your garbage. While that might seem bizarre to some people it’s actually a very routine habit to get into. Essentially all you need to do is separate anything made of paper or metal versus food scraps. All of those paper products such as magazines, newspapers, junk mail, cereal boxes and other cardboard items are perfect materials for recycling. If the mandatory program passes in Charlotte you’ll be given a big blue bin that you could fill up weekly. Even just one week of recycling will show you just how much of this kind of garbage you would normally throw out. If all that cardboard and paper can avoid going to one of the many landfills around Charlotte then it’s going to be a benefit for everyone.

The purpose of a landfill is to gather trash and let it sit there until it breaks down to its basic chemical components. By allowing garbage to do that it really is going to waste. Paper products that make their way into a recycling facility are shredded into pulp and then repackaged into regular paper. Before the popular reality series based on the lives of hoarders came along, there were many noteworthy cases of hoarders who would crop up in the news. One of the most famous was the 1947 discovery of the Collyer brothers. These were two very well to do New York City residents who lived in a mansion and died there among literally hundreds tons of junk. Just last year a woman was smothered when a massive pile of clothes she had been ordering fell on her and she had no escape.
There are also many instances of hoarders homes going up in flames because of all the hazardous material stored within the walls to create a veritable tinderbox.
